OIL RESERVOIR

  -  The oil reservoir-separator combines multiple functions into one vessel.  The lower 

half is the oil reservoir, providing oil storage capacity for the system and the top portion, a primary oil 
separation means.  The reservoir also provides limited air storage for control and gauge actuation. 

 

COMPRESSOR OIL SEPARATOR

  -  The compressor oil separator located on the manifold with the 

minimum pressure/check valve  features a renewable spin-on type separator element and provides the 
final removal of oil from the air flow. 

 

Oil carry-over through the service lines may be caused by a faulty oil separator, overfilling of the oil 
reservoir, oil that foams, oil return line malfunction, or water condensate in the oil.  If oil carryover occurs, 
inspect the separator only after it is determined that the oil level is not too high, the oil is not foaming 
excessively, the oil return tube from the bottom of the separator manifold to the compressor cylinder is not 
clogged or pinched off, the check valve in the oil return is functioning properly, and there is not water or 
an oil/water emulsion in the oil. 

 

Oil carry-over malfunctions of the oil separator are usually due to using elements too long, heavy dirt or 
varnish deposits caused by inadequate air filter service, use of improper oil, or using oil too long for 
existing conditions.  Excessive tilt angle of the unit will also hamper separation and cause oil carry-over. 

 

Oil separator element life cannot be predicted; it will vary greatly depending on the conditions of 
operation, the quality of the oil used and the maintenance of the oil and air filters.  The condition of the 
separator can be determined by pressure differential or by inspection. 

 

 Separator Pressure Differential 

- The “CHANGE SEPARATOR” message will flash when the pressure 

differential across the oil separator reaches approximately 8 psi (.6 bar).  Replace the oil separator 
element at this time.  If ignored, the unit will shut down and the display will  indicate shutdown and the 
change separator text advisory will display when the pressure differential reaches 15 psi (1 bar). 

 

To measure the pressure differential,  see Controller Manual 13-17-600, page 4, “Separator Pressure 
Differential”.  Simply subtract the downstream reading from the upstream reading. 

 

 

Using an oil separator element at excessive pressure differential can cause 
damage to equipment.  Replace the separator when the “Change Separator” 
advisory appears.
